                      I have the Tacstar plastic ones on all my shotguns; they are economical and work perfectly. They have maintained their retention force on the shells over many years without fail; I've never had a shell drop and some of my carriers have been continuously loaded for up to 9 years. I think many possess little knowledge of material properties and automatically assume aluminum is somehow a "higher quality" material than "plastic". I guess all of those "plastic framed" (HK, Sig, Glock Springfield, Walther, S&W, etc. etc.) handguns are of lower quality than aluminum or steel framed guns?
